Hi ShawBee, good to hear your kids seem to be coping well.

Unfortunately support for families of trans people is sadly inadequate. What does exist is mainly online rather than face to face. There may be things I don't know about but I think it unlikely you will find something so specific as a group for teenagers in your area. I run a group for partners and family in Scotland and I believe it is the only group of its kind up here. There is a new group similar to ours planned for Manchester. I do not know of anything closer to you.

Perhaps your kids could join the family section of the Depend support forum.
